Tirios vs Rockhampton, Queensland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Tirios, Brazil and Rockhampton, Queensland, Australia is approximately 16,324 km or 10,144 mi.
  • To reach Tirios in this distance one would set out from Rockhampton, Queensland bearing 125.7°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Tirios bearing 48.3° or NE .
  • Tirios has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Rockhampton, Queensland has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Tirios is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Rockhampton, Queensland is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 1.8 °C (3.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.3 °C (14.9°F) less in Tirios.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 895.4 mm (35.3 in) more which is equivalent to 895.4 l/m² (21.98 US gal/ft²) or 8,954,000 l/ha (957,242 US gal/ac) more. About 2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9° higher in Tirios than in Rockhampton, Queensland.
  • Relative humidity levels are 33.4%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 9.9°C (17.9°F) higher.
